I am searching for Doyle family members in Bansha.
Specifically:
- the baptism of my gggrandfather, James Doyle in about 1811 (his mother was Mary Conway and father possibly William)
- the baptisms between about 1840 and 1850 of seven of his children with wife Julia Leary – William, John and James (twins), Maria, Annie Eliza, Julia Teresa, and Margaret May.
I have been fortunate in finding other records for this family from Galbally on the ROOTSIRELAND site ie marriage of James and Julia, baptism of two younger children and baptism of Julia and her siblings. However, names I had were O’Leary and Crowe which appear as Leary and Croagh in the Galbally records. I am assuming that these are alternative spellings.

Jill
It seems The parish priests in Galbally Aherlow dropped the "O" and Mac from names when recording names in this register.Crow , Croagh are all spellings of the local Crowes as they are known today
